Ulland, James E. "Jim"

House 1969-72 (District 61A); House 1973-76 (District 8B); Senate 1977-84 (District 8)

Party when first elected:  Nonpartisan Election-Conservative Caucus

Counties Served:  Carlton, Cook, Lake, St. Louis

BIOGRAPHICAL INFORMATION

Date of Birth: 6/30/1942

City of Residence (when first elected): French River
Occupation (when first elected): Economist/Tree Farmer

EDUCATION

Duluth East High School; Secondary; 1960
Carleton College; B.A.; Economics, 1964
University of Pennsylvania, Wharton School of Finance; M.B.A.; Dean's List, 1966

OTHER GOVERNMENT SERVICE

State Agency: Minnesota Department of Commerce (Commissioner); 09/01/1993 to 1995 [Appointed]

GENERAL NOTES

Special Legislative Concerns: housing, economics, energy, high technology, senior citizens.

He was a member of the Republican Party.
